google搜索 站内搜索                 软件测试门户 | 软件测试培训 | 文章资料精选 | 软件测试论坛 | 测试解决方案 | 软件测试博客 | 测试招聘求职 
打印

[讨论] 如果整个系统都用描述性编程来实现可以么?

如果整个系统都用描述性编程来实现可以么?


大家头脑风暴一下,脚本是用录制好呢?还是全用描述性编程来实现好呢?

TOP

不怕累死应该还是可以这样做的~~

TOP

完全可以,只要是 成本和时间都允许
实践是检验真理的唯一标准。

TOP

不过,还是建议如下:
对于属性不会发生变化和不应该发生不变化的 对象, 还是用 录制的方式,让QTP自动生成代码,同时在对象库里面增加对象;或者是 先把这些对象增加到对象库里面,然后根据业务逻辑和需要自己写代码。
对于属性经常会发生变化的对象,特别是 需求不是很确定的情况,还是用 描述性编程来写吧。
实践是检验真理的唯一标准。

TOP

早已经有人完全使用描述性编程来写测试脚本了。。。

还是不建议这样做,完全没这个必要,并且吃力不讨好
路漫漫其修远兮,吾需努力再努力

欢迎加我MSN共同讨论QTP疑难杂症~加好友时请注明51testing~

TOP

我写的第一个版本基本都用描述性编程,现在虽然也用,但相当多部分还是使用对象库。
建议,对象在脚本中出现次数较少的可以用描述性,较多的用对象库。

TOP

支持


我们做过的两个项目全是使用描述性编程实现的,对象库里没有一个对象,开发新的框架的,不是使用QC,而是使用VBA,所有单体测试,和连接测试都是这样,个人感觉还可以,框架可以重复使用。就是还不太完善!

TOP

 
当前时区 GMT+8, 现在时间是 2008-12-5 23:43Copyright(C)上海博为峰软件技术有限公司 2001-2007 电话:021-64471599-8017
当您在访问网站、论坛及博客过程中遇到问题时可发送email:webmaster@51testing.com或发送论坛短信至管理员风在吹